Micron Technology Inc. is a Fortune 500 company employing more than 45,000 team members (and growing) worldwide. Micron offers the semiconductor industry’s broadest portfolio of memory solutions—starting with foundational DRAM, NAND, and NOR Flash memory, extending to SSDs, MCPs, HMCs, and other memory-based systems. As the only memory fab in the western hemisphere, Micron has been in the industry for nearly forty-five years and continues to be the only U.S.-based DRAM manufacturer. Micron is one of the most prolific patent applicants in the world with 50,000 patents granted and still growing.

Responsibilities:

  • Monitor the health of assigned processes and ensure high-quality output

  • Provide proactive redundancy plans for potential bottlenecks that could impact Fab cycle time (CT) or turns

  • Successfully complete all necessary safety training and adhere to established safety protocols.

  • Collaborate with multi-disciplinary teams to address tool process challenges and optimize tool output.

  • Analyze data to make critical decisions and drive cost reduction activities

  • Oversee projects to ensure all tasks are accomplished according to the defined scope, schedule, and budget.

  • Use Python, JMP, Tableau, Power-BI, and other coding languages to implement AI/Machine-learning principles that help decrease engineering time.

  • Offer assistance in resolving intricate process challenges and identifying underlying causes.

Requirements:

  • Bachelor's degree in science or engineering or equivalent experience

  • Demonstrated automation skills through previous automation projects requiring coding/machine learning/JMP scripting

  • Strong ability to perform functions of this role with minimal supervision

  • Understanding of semiconductor processes with an emphasis on film deposition and Ion Implant

  • Strong leadership and teamwork skills

  • Proven ability to communicate effectively to all audiences

  • Strong analytical problem-solving skills

  • Proven time management and organization skills

  • 2+ years of experience in an engineering position (preferred)
